An illegal alien from Guatemala has been charged with stabbing to death a 16-year-old girl in Long Branch, New Jersey.

Bryan Cordero-Castro, a 20-year-old illegal alien, has been arrested and charged after allegedly stabbing to death 16-year-old Madison Wells, according to the Monmouth County Prosecutor.
Police say Wells was stabbed to death by Cordero-Castro on the night of September 8. Investigators said the illegal alien stabbed her at a residence blocks away from her home in Long Branch. When police arrived on the scene, Wells was taken to a nearby hospital where she was pronounced dead.

According to the police, Cordero-Castro and Wells knew one another and worked together, but they are still unclear about the motive for the young woman’s brutal death.
The illegal alien is now facing first-degree murder charges, third-degree possession of a weapon for an unlawful purpose charges, and third-degree attempted escape charges.
Wells’ family has set up a GoFundMe account to pay for the girl’s funeral costs.

An illegal alien has been arrested and charged with sexually abusing a child in Boaz, Alabama after allegedly confessing to the crime.

Antonio Corince, a 29-year-old illegal alien, turned himself into the Boaz Police Department and allegedly confessed to sexually abusing a child for months.
“This is something that will haunt them the rest of their lives,” Boaz Chief of Police Josh Gaskin told WAAY31 about the sexual abuse suffered by the child.
Police say they began investigating the sexual abuse last month when it was first reported. After conducting their investigation, the illegal alien allegedly came forward, via a translator, and confessed to the crime.
The illegal alien’s neighbor, Chriseve Turner, told WAAY31 that the news of the crime came as a shock to her.
“[I] didn’t realize that we had any problems like this in the neighborhood. I was told I was living besides good people,” Turner said in the interview.
Corince is being held in the Etowah County Jail on a $50,000 bond. The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agency has been notified so that should the illegal alien be released at any time, he will be turned over to ICE agents for deportation out of the U.S.

The illegal alien charged with murdering 20-year-old college student Mollie Tibbetts has reportedly been granted $5,000 in American taxpayer dollars to fight the first-degree murder charges against him.

Last month, law enforcement officials announced that Tibbetts’ body was found in a cornfield in her rural hometown of Brooklyn, Iowa after she was last seen jogging on July 18.
Illegal alien Cristhian Bahena-Rivera, a 24-year-old from Mexico, has been charged with first-degree murder in Tibbetts’ death after police say he admitted to confronting and chasing down the young woman. The illegal alien lived in a region of Iowa that was surrounded by sanctuary cities, as Breitbart News noted, and an initial autopsy report revealed that Bahena-Rivera allegedly stabbed Tibbetts to death.
Radar Online exclusive report claims to have obtained court records that reveal how Bahena-Rivera asked the court and was granted $5,000 in taxpayer money to fight the charges:
Radar obtained exclusive documents indicating the suspected murderer asked for an initial $5,000 to retain company Gratias Investigations, noting “this amount is probably considerably less than what will actually be necessary to conduct all investigation in this matter.” [Emphasis added]
Rivera’s lawyers said they wouldn’t disclose details as to why the suspected killer wants his own investigators, except behind closed doors at a hearing.
In a puzzling decision, a judge granted Rivera’s request for $5,000 for the team of investigators, though any additional amount needed would require further approval. [Emphasis added]
In other records obtained by Radar Online, Bahena-Rivera allegedly admits in a handwritten affidavit that he and no one else in the residence where he lived — owned by the Lang family who also own Yarabee Farms where the illegal alien worked — actually worked or had an income.
Last week, the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agency led an investigation at Yarrabee Farms where Bahena-Rivera worked since 2014 when he was first hired using the alias “John Budd” and stolen ID. The Iowa Division of Criminal Investigation was also present during the raid, but officials said they were only there to assist ICE and the Department of Homeland Security.


According to police, Bahena-Rivera was the last person who saw Tibbetts jogging on the evening of July 18 in Brooklyn, Iowa, security camera footage reveals. That is the night Tibbetts went missing.
The illegal alien told police that Tibbetts was jogging when he saw her. That is when he said he approached Tibbetts and started talking to her. After Tibbetts allegedly told Bahena-Rivera that she would call the police if he did not stop following her, the illegal alien allegedly chased her and says he “blacked out” after this.
The following month, Tibbetts’ body was found in a cornfield where prosecutors say Bahena-Rivera placed corn stalks over her to hide her body.
Bahena-Rivera is being held on a $5 million cash bond.
